A very well self made 6x6 Renault(or MAN?) from Belgium. The caravan in neatly integrated to the bed. 395/85-20 tyres and some sort of portal axles.
















 Steyr Pinzgauer camper van from France.



This is not a budget car. 6x6 MAN from Italy. Very nice design.


Proper tyres 16.00R20




These two Mogs came in last minute so only photos are taken from the ship 





The green cabin Mog  was the same model as mine U1300L year 1982 and the owner claimed that his has no problems with the portal oil. Box is commercial Ormocar box.
